- Ampere Swimming Rule (A) → (III): Direction of deflection of magnetic needle due to current.
- Fleming’s Left Hand Rule (B) → (IV): Direction of force on a current carrying conductor due to magnetic field.
- Fleming’s Right Hand Rule (C) → (I): Direction of induced current in a conductor.
- Right Hand Thumb Rule (D) → (II): Direction of magnetic field lines due to current through circular coil.
